- [ ] Step 7: Archive cold storage buckets (Glacierline tier). Confirm both ceremony witnesses are present, verify bucket manifests match the Oxbow ledger, then seal the archive key shares. Plugin authors may observe but not handle shares. Once sealed, the archive index itself is encrypted and can only be reopened with the passphrase below.

vault phrase of badup-hahig = tamael-aldael-kelmir-istael-fenok-istwyn-tamius-jorath-oliion

# Artifact Signing — Meridly Calendar Sync

Last week's sync conflict between Meridly's event-merge service and the Tallgrass scheduler was traced to an unsigned hotfix artifact. Going forward, every calendar-sync build must be signed before promotion, no exceptions for conflict patches. The pipeline rejects unsigned uploads as of this sprint. For this week's builds, use the signing key below.

signing key of bagap-yawep = bky13_TbfT6ZMUoGJo2

TICKET-4482: Vault locked, blocking reset-flow revamp

The Keldway secrets vault sealed itself after three failed unseal attempts during last night's deploy. Password reset flow revamp is blocked — staging can't fetch signing keys. Auto-unseal won't recover; manual unseal needed before Thursday's sync or the milestone slips. Two operators already entered their shares. Third share holder is out; approved fallback is the emergency passphrase, recorded below for the on-call.

unlock words, kagef-taduf: fenir-quenix-norwyn-sorvan-gormir-gorir-fraok

- [ ] Spooler compatibility check (Inkmere print service). Plugin authors must confirm their render hooks tolerate the new job-claim lease of 90 seconds: jobs not acknowledged in time are requeued, and duplicate submission is now rejected rather than silently merged. Test against the staging spooler with at least one multi-page job and one cancellation mid-render. Document any hook timing assumptions in your manifest. Certification runs should target the build recorded below.

pipeline stamp: htk9_ce63042d9